ROSé'S BACCALà SALAD
Steps:
- Put cod in a large bowl and cover with cold water by 2 inches. Soak cod, chilled, changing water 3 times a day, up to 3 days (see cooks' note, below). Drain and chill until ready to use.
- Drain cod and transfer to a 5- to 6-quart pot with 1 1/2 quarts water. Bring just to a simmer and remove from heat. (Cod will just flake; do not boil or it will become tough.) Gently transfer cod with a slotted spoon to a platter to cool slightly.
- Shred cod and stir together with celery, garlic, olives, roasted peppers, parsley, and basil.
- Stir together lemon juice, vinegar, sugar, and oil, then pour over salad, tossing to coat well. Season with pepper and chill, covered, at least 1 1/2 hours for flavors to develop.

MOCK BACCALLA SALAD
Baccalla is dried and salted cod. I like a good baccalla salad, but I do not enjoy preparing the salted cod which requires soaking and changing the water for three days. In this recipe, I substitute fresh cod. Poaching gives it a nice texture for the salad. Though, not quite as toothy as the dried fish. The salad may be eaten immediately after preparation, but gets better if allowed to marinate for a couple of hours.
Provided by Jim D.
Categories European
Time 20m
Yield 4-6 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 12
Steps:
- Combine the cod, olive oil, salt and water in a saucepan.
- Bring the water to a boil.
- Reduce heat to a simmer and poach gently for 10 minutes.
- Drain, rinse, and cool.
- Flake cod with a fork.
- Combine remaining ingredients.
- Add cod, stir together gently.
- Place covered in the refrigerator for 2-4 hours or overnight. (The fish absorbs more flavor).
